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Bentley (Hampshire) to Penryn (Cornwall) start from as little as £41.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Bentley (Hampshire) to Penryn (Cornwall) start from £87.30 one way, or £140.90 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Bentley (Hampshire) to Penryn (Cornwall) are available for £136.80 one way, or £166.50 return

Facilities and Amenities at Bentley Station

The station is equipped with a variety of amenities to ensure a smooth travel experience. Ticket buying is made convenient with an accessible ticket machine that caters to all passenger needs, including those with a Disabled Persons Railcard. While the ticket office operates from Monday to Friday, it's open from 06:40 to 10:30, ensuring early travelers can secure their tickets before a day’s adventure.

Although staff assistance is not available at the station, help points are accessible for customer enquiries. Step-free access is featured at Bentley, although some areas might be a bit challenging due to steep gradients. Unfortunately, there aren’t any accessible toilets or baby changing facilities, so planning ahead is advised.

For those arriving by car, Bentley station offers a car park with 96 spaces, including two for disabled parking. Pricing varies by duration, with options ranging from an hourly rate to annual passes. Bicycle enthusiasts can benefit from 23 parking spaces and CCTV protection for added security.

Station Facilities and Accessibility

Penryn train station, while modest, offers key facilities to ensure a smooth journey. Though it lacks a ticket office, there are ticket machines available for purchasing and collecting your travel tickets. Accessibility is a top priority - the station offers step-free access throughout, making it easy for passengers with mobility needs. Customer help points are present, complemented by departure screens, announcements, and assistance for passengers requiring help. If you are planning a trip, assistance can be requested up to two hours before your journey starts through the Passenger Assist service. However, bear in mind that there are no refreshment facilities, ATM, or waiting rooms at the station.
